Write an equivalent C function long try (unsigned long x) for the following x86 code: try: moxa %rdi, -24%rbp) moxe $0,-
Posted: Mon Mar 21, 2022 4:47 pm
Write an equivalent C function long try (unsigned long x) for the following x86 code: try: moxa %rdi, -24%rbp) moxe $0,-16(%rbp) moxo $64,-8(%rbp) im L2 .L3: moxg -16(%rbp), %rax adda %rax. %rax moxg %rax. %rdx moxg -24%rbn), %rax andl $1, %eax ora %rdx. %rax moxa %rax. -16%rbr) sbra -24%rbp) subg $1,-8(%rbp) .L2: cmpg $0,-8(%rbn) ine .L3 moxg -16%rbp), %rax ret